What is the competitive landscape for CellaVision?

The medical diagnostics field is rapidly advancing, with digital microscopy and AI leading the charge. CellaVision, a Swedish medical technology firm, is at the forefront of this transformation, specializing in digital solutions for hematology. Since its founding in 1994, the company has aimed to simplify and digitize blood cell analysis.

Where Does CellaVision’ Stand in the Current Market?

CellaVision is a significant player in the digital cell morphology system market, a sector anticipated to reach USD 2.5 billion by 2032 with an 8.1% CAGR from 2023. The company specializes in instruments, reagents, and software for analyzing blood and other body fluids in laboratories and hospitals.

Icon Market Leadership in Digital Cell Morphology

CellaVision is recognized as a major global manufacturer within the digital cell morphology sector. This positions them prominently against other key industry participants.

Icon Core Offerings and Target Market

The company's product suite includes instruments, reagents, and software designed for the routine analysis of blood and body fluids. Their solutions cater to a broad range of laboratory and hospital sizes.

Icon Financial Performance Highlights (Q1 2025)

In the first quarter of 2025, CellaVision reported net sales of SEK 195 million, a 14.6% increase from SEK 170 million in Q1 2024. The EBITDA saw a substantial rise to SEK 66 million, with an improved EBITDA margin of 34%.

Icon Financial Performance Highlights (Q2 2025)

For the second quarter of 2025, net sales reached SEK 191 million, marking a 1.9% increase year-over-year. The EBITDA margin stood at 31%, reflecting continued operational strength.

CellaVision's strategic financial goals include achieving a 15% CAGR and an EBITDA margin exceeding 30% over the economic cycle, demonstrating a focus on sustainable growth and profitability. Geographic Market Presence and Growth

CellaVision operates globally through partners and local support organizations in over 40 countries. The EMEA region was a strong performer in Q1 2025 with a 21% sales increase, while the APAC region showed robust growth of 23% in Q2 2025.

  • EMEA region sales grew by 21% in Q1 2025.
  • APAC region sales increased by 23% in Q2 2025.
  • The company maintains a solid financial structure with minimal debt.
  • Currency fluctuations and market dynamics influenced performance in the Americas and EMEA in Q2 2025.

Who Are the Main Competitors Challenging CellaVision?

The CellaVision competitive landscape is dynamic, with several key players shaping the digital cell morphology system market. Understanding these competitors is crucial for a comprehensive CellaVision market analysis.

The market is characterized by both direct and indirect competition, with companies offering a range of solutions from automated microscopy to AI-driven diagnostic tools. This environment necessitates continuous innovation and strategic partnerships to maintain market position.

Icon

Sysmex Corporation

Sysmex Corporation is a significant competitor in the hematology space. CellaVision has a strategic alliance with Sysmex, extending their collaboration until 2038. This partnership aims to leverage Sysmex's hematology expertise and CellaVision's imaging and AI capabilities.

Icon

West Medica and Medica Corporation

West Medica and Medica Corporation are also identified as key global manufacturers in the digital cell morphology system market. Their presence indicates a broader competitive field with multiple established entities.

Icon

Roche Diagnostics

Roche Diagnostics is another major player, contributing to the competitive intensity within the clinical diagnostics sector. Their involvement highlights the importance of integrated diagnostic solutions.

Icon

Fraunhofer IIS

Fraunhofer IIS represents a research-oriented competitor, often involved in developing advanced technologies that can influence the market. Their contributions can drive innovation and set new benchmarks.

Icon

Mindray

Mindray is a global medical device manufacturer that competes in various laboratory automation solutions. Their broad product portfolio often includes offerings that intersect with digital cell morphology.

Icon

Emerging and Niche Competitors

Beyond the larger corporations, companies like MicroX Labs, LabNow, and Diatron also contribute to the competitive dynamic. These players often focus on specific market segments or technological advancements, particularly in AI-powered diagnostics.

What Gives CellaVision a Competitive Edge Over Its Rivals?

CellaVision's competitive advantages are built upon its deep-seated expertise in sample preparation, advanced image analysis, and the integration of artificial intelligence (AI). The company has been a pioneer in AI for over three decades, applying it to tasks like pre-classifying white blood cells and characterizing red blood cell morphologies. A standout patented innovation is their AI-based absolute focus method, which significantly boosts analyzer speed by precisely determining image focus and optimizing image acquisition, a capability not replicated by competitors.

The company's product suite, including analyzers like the CellaVision DC-1, DM1200, and DM9600, alongside software applications such as the CellaVision Peripheral Blood Application and Advanced RBC Application, provides a distinct and adaptable automation concept. These solutions are designed to streamline laboratory workflows and enhance skill development by replacing manual processes. The 2019 acquisition of RAL Diagnostics further solidified CellaVision's control over sample preparation quality, a crucial element for accurate digital morphology.

Icon Proprietary AI and Patented Technology

CellaVision's AI-based absolute focus method is a key differentiator, enhancing analyzer speed. Their AI algorithms are central to their competitive edge in digital cell morphology.

Icon Integrated Workflow Solutions

The company offers a comprehensive suite of instruments and software designed to automate manual laboratory tasks. This integrated approach aims to improve efficiency and accuracy in clinical diagnostics.

Icon Strategic Partnership with Sysmex

The extended alliance with Sysmex Corporation, running until 2038, is a significant advantage. This collaboration integrates CellaVision's digital morphology with Sysmex's hematology analyzers, fostering joint innovation and market reach.

Icon Commitment to Research and Development

CellaVision's substantial investment in R&D, representing 22% of sales in Q1 and Q2 2025, underscores its dedication to continuous innovation. This focus is crucial for maintaining its leadership in the digital cytology market.

What Industry Trends Are Reshaping CellaVision’s Competitive Landscape?

The digital cell morphology market is experiencing significant evolution, driven by advancements in artificial intelligence (AI) and high-resolution imaging. AI-powered decision support systems are enhancing diagnostic accuracy and efficiency for pathologists, with machine learning models demonstrating high precision in cell differentiation. The convergence of digital cell morphology with other 'omics' technologies, such as genomics and proteomics, is fostering a more comprehensive approach to cellular analysis and personalized medicine. Automation is also a key trend, aiming to boost laboratory productivity and reduce operational expenditures. The broader hematology analyzer market is anticipated to reach USD 8.82 billion by 2032,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7.5% from 2025, fueled by the increasing incidence of blood disorders and the wider adoption of automated testing. Future Opportunities and Strategic Partnerships

Significant growth opportunities are present, particularly in emerging markets like the Asia-Pacific region, which is projected to experience the fastest growth in the digital cell morphology system market with a CAGR of 9.2%. Countries such as China and India are making substantial investments in healthcare infrastructure and AI-driven pathology solutions. Product innovations, like the anticipated CE Mark for CellaVision's bone marrow module by 2026, are poised to unlock new market avenues. Strategic alliances, such as the extended collaboration with Sysmex until 2038, are vital for expanding market reach and fostering innovation.
